使用PHP进行MySQL操作的封装技巧(mysqlphp封装)
MySQL是一个十分流行的开源数据库,它被广泛应用于各种网站、应用程序中,能够有效地保存、处理大量数据,能够提供更高性能和更好的系统可靠性。使用PHP进行MySQL操作可以有效地实现对数据库进行增删改查操作,但是开发人员需要付出更大的努力来处理数据,并保证程序的可维护性和可扩展性。
要实现这些目的,可以将多个MySQL语句封装在一个类或函数内,这样就可以直接以对象或函数的形式来执行MySQL操作,在独立的函数内处理数据,使得代码变的简洁易懂,同时还能够方便地复用函数。
例如,定义一个名为queryDB的函数,使用MySQL查询语句从数据库中查询结果。此函数可以定义为:
“`php
function queryDB($mysql_link,$sql){
$result = mysqli_query($mysql_link,$sql);
if($result && mysqli_affected_rows($mysql_link) > 0){
$row_num = mysqli_num_rows($result);
if($row_num == 0)
{
return false;
}
else
{
for($i=0; $i
{
$row = mysqli_fetch_array($result,MYSQLI_ASSOC);
$rows[$i] = $row;
}
return $rows;
}
}
else
{
return false;
}
}
?>
以上函数已经将MySQL语句封装到单个函数中,开发者可以使用以下语法结构直接调用:
```php
$rows = queryDB($mysql_link,'SELECT * FROM users');?>
以上就是使用PHP进行MySQL操作的封装技巧,该方法可以有效地将多个MySQL语句封装在单个函数内,简化开发者对数据库的操作,使得程序变得更易懂、更易维护、更可扩展。